对于一家销售公司,最重要的就是要卖出产品。在卖出产品前,有一个重要的环节,那就是报价,客户往往会选择一个报价较低的公司来进货。在本章中我们将开发一个报价管理系统,通过该系统可以管理公司的产品、客户、订单以及报价,从而提高销售公司的竞争力以及销售能力。
! \& Y/ ~0 P: O7 b重点内容:
7 M2 K( }/ [. N; x4 H B•了解报价管理系统的基本需求# o1 Y9 E3 ?6 p0 Q1 ]. ^& r
•学会如何分析和设计数据库# J1 W2 h! Z5 v
•学会数据库的基本使用
8 M: Q" z& v, G D0 k" u•学会如何使用struts2+JPA+spring进行开发0 b! |8 l, I# p \
功能 分析:
! a+ a; F1 {- y; ^- G' U% k" d报价管理系统可以分为五个功能模块,分别是客户管理模块、产品管理模块、订单管理模块、报价管理模块以及系统用户管理模块,其中各功能模块的具体说明如下。 客户管理模块:该模块主要用来管理客户信息,包括客户的名称、联系电话、联系地址、联系人等信息。 产品管理模块:该模块主要用来管理产品类别和产品信息,包括产品的名称、产品的单位、产品的价格等信息。 订单管理模块:该模块主要用来管理订单信息,包括下单客户名称、产品名称、产品数量等信息。 报价管理模块:该模块主要用来管理报价信息,包括客户名称、产品名称、报价人、报价时间等信息。 系统用户管理模块:该模块用来管理系统用户信息,包括用户名、用户级别、用户密码等信息。 部分截图: 登陆首页: 产品管理: 报价管理:
u- G' X0 m1 V/ d; _6 Y 4 z; E: s# R2 [
/ I: `5 J& D4 v1 J8 T1 H ?. h
* s1 U& p$ [4 f. h
源码地址下载: " G | V. J' W- W8 E+ L' f
5 F9 g; w" h0 r4 x* Y# v( ^
. B1 k' P! c8 e3 ]3 a2 h6 ^' g& X/ Q$ q; N8 D9 m7 Y2 e4 c
3 |: U% C6 C7 p" p
" j/ [( w& }% `( e) z5 ~8 f& R
|